EIA: China promoting both fuel efficiency and alternative-fuel vehicles to curb growing oil use

Green Car Congress

To counter this trend triggered by China’s rapid motorization, the Chinese government is adopting a broad range of policies, including improvements in the fuel economy of new vehicles and the promotion of alternative-fuel vehicles, EIA notes.
